Estonian MFA: Egypt EU's key partner in solving multiple crises
The ministers noted that the European Union and Egypt must
jointly find a solution for the problems of illegal migration, extremism and
terrorism, spokespeople for the Estonian Foreign Ministry said.
"Cooperation and exchange of information must be improved in order to cope
better," Mikser said.
The ministers discussed intensifying the relations between the two
countries, the relations between Egypt and the European Union and the situation
in the southern neighborhood of the EU, including Lybia. Speaking about the
Estonian presidency of the Council of the European Union, Mikser said that
stability in the southern neighborhood and in the Middle East in general is
very important for Estonia. "The situation east as well as south of
the European Union is of strategic importance to us as it is directly
linked with the security of Europe," Mikser said in a press release.
Mikser and Shoukry said that the relations between Estonia
and Egypt are good and mapped the opportunities for increasing
cooperation. "Estonia, for its part, remains prepared to share its
experience as an e-state, we will contribute to the digital topics of the
EU-Africa summit," Mikser said. He expressed hope that Egypt's
tourism sector recover as well, as tourism is the leading sector of Egypt's
economy and the country has been an important destination for Estonian
tourists, but also pointed out the importance of ensuring the safety of the
tourists.
Mikser also recognized the Egypt's achievements so far in carrying out
significant economic reforms. The ministers also discussed cooperation in
international organizations.
This is the first high level official visit from Egypt to Estonia.
